Personnel appeals board—Composition—Appointment.

(1) The personnel appeals board shall consist of three members appointed by the governor and confirmed by the senate. Each member must be qualified by experience and training in the field of administrative procedures and merit principles.
(2) No member shall hold other employment with the state.
(3) No member may during the term to which he/she is appointed be or become a candidate for public office, hold any other public office or trust, engage in any occupation or business which interferes or is inconsistent with his/her duties as a member of the board, serve on or under any committee of any political party nor have been an officer of a political party for a period of one year immediately prior to appointment.
(4) No member may act in a representative capacity before the board on any matter for a period of one year after the termination of his/her membership on the board.
(5) Members of the board shall serve overlapping terms of six years. A member appointed to fill a vacancy occurring prior to the expiration of a term shall be appointed for the remainder of that term. Each member shall continue to hold office after expiration of his/her term until a successor has been appointed.
(6) The board shall elect a chairperson and vice chairperson from among its members in July of each year to serve one year.
